文章目录
1. 概述
1.1 什么是DSI
分布式系统接口(DSI)是一种通用且功能强大的总线协议,旨在将多个遥感器和执行器设备互连到中央控制模块。该网络的主要目标应用是汽车安全系统。这种应用的一些特点是需要低成本、高鲁棒性、中速互连,仅限于两根导线。此外,它必须具有故障安全性、确定性和良好的EMC特性。即使具有所有级别的智能和可编程性的设备都可以连接到网络,远程设备也必须能够通过简单的状态机实现。由于模块尺寸非常重要,因此中央模块和远程单元中的最小组件至关重要。
汽车安全系统有许多类型的部件可以连接到网络。通常,这些部件由供应商直接交付至车辆装配厂。一些可能嵌入仪表板和转向柱中,其他可能嵌入座椅中,其他可能嵌入线束中。远程设备的数量通常为两位数。出于这些原因,非常希望在通电时允许网络寻址进行自我配置。这将设备类型的数量降至最低,并消除了部件供应商和车辆装配厂对特殊编程设备的需求。
上述问题在DSI的开发中至关重要。为了在不牺牲总线带宽和简单性的情况下保持确定性,使用了单主/多从配置。通过使用消息循环冗余码(CRCÿ